James H. Delaney
President and Chief Executive Officer
James Delaney leads Marketwired’s corporate vision, business direction and global strategy. Most recently, he served as Marketwired’s Chief Operating Officer, steering the day-to-day operations of the company. Prior to his tenure at Marketwire, Jim built a reputation for delivering exceptional results for prominent international companies. From 2006 to 2011 he served as President, Global Sales & Marketing Solutions for Dun & Bradstreet where he pioneered the development of its Data-as-a-Service platform, which transformed the commercial data industry and today represents Dun & Bradstreet’s largest growth strategy. As senior vice president of card services at JPMorgan Chase & Co., Jim led his product portfolio to unprecedented growth and acquired 500,000 new customers in a single year – the most in the program's history. He has held a number of other senior management and marketing leadership positions at respected financial institutions including Colonial Penn Insurance and FirstUSA. Jim is a graduate of the U.S. Naval Academy and received his MBA from the Wharton School at the University of Pennsylvania.

Stephen Devito
Chief Financial Officer
As Marketwired's CFO, Stephen Devito oversees the Company's worldwide finance organization with responsibility for financial reporting, tax and legal matters, investor relations, and mergers and acquisitions. He also leads the facilities and human resources teams. In conjunction with the Chief Executive Officer, Stephen is instrumental in determining the organization's business and financial strategies. With over 13 years of financial, operational and strategic planning experience in both private and public companies, Stephen has succeeded in taking companies through rapid growth and expansion, including initial public offerings, hostile take-over bids, restructurings, and more. Stephen joined Marketwired in 2008 after leaving his post of CFO at Second Cup Royalty Income Fund (TSX: SCU.UN), the largest franchiser of specialty coffee cafés in Canada. Prior to Second Cup, Stephen held leadership roles at DWL Incorporated, a fast growing CRM solutions company specializing in the insurance area, PricewaterhouseCoopers LLP, the world's largest professional services firm and Schwartz Levitsky Feldman LLP, a mid-sized professional services firm with head offices in Toronto and Montreal. Stephen is a designated Chartered Accountant with the Institute of Chartered Accountants of Ontario and holds a Bachelor of Commerce degree from the University of Toronto.

Dr. Nick Koudas
President and Co-founder, Sysomos – a Marketwire Company
Nick is a professor at the University of Toronto's computer science department. He holds more than twenty patents and has published more than 100 research publications in the areas of database systems, text analytics and information mining. Nick serves on the editorial review boards of four scientific journals related to data management systems and data analysis, and sits on the program committees for leading data management conferences.
Before joining U of T he was a member of AT&T's research laboratories' technical staff.

Darin Wolter
Executive Vice President, Global Sales
In 2004, Darin Wolter joined Marketwired as Vice President of Sales for its Western U.S. region. In his first six years, Marketwired’s profits increased nearly 100-fold and the Company’s market share in the news distribution space climbed dramatically. During this time, Darin was promoted to Senior Vice President Sales and his territory oversight grew to include all of Europe and Asia. Under Darin’s watch, Marketwired’s sales staff grew more than 500%, which was buoyed by new office openings in San Francisco, New York City, Boston, Austin and London (U.K.). In 2010, Darin was named Marketwired’s Executive Vice President of Global Sales where he now directs the Company's sales revenue and growth efforts worldwide. Darin brings nearly two decades of sales experience to Marketwired along with a deep knowledge of the financial industry and emerging technologies. A former sales executive with Thomson Financial, Darin held key national management positions (including Vice President and Managing Director) of Thomson's Outbound Sales Team. Prior to Thomson (now Thomson Reuters) Darin held direct sales and management roles at successfully acquired start-ups, StreetFusion and Questlink Technology, in addition to holding key advertising sales positions at Miller Freeman. Darin earned his BA in English from Miami University of Ohio.
